PROCEDURE

实验过程

400 grams (4 moles) of methyl methacrylate, 4.74 (73 millimoles) grams of KCN and 0.118 gram (250 ppm) of N,N'-diphenylbenzidine in a 1 liter round bottom flask were heated to 90° to 100° C. with passage of air therethrough. Within one further hour there were charged 74 grams (1 mole) of glycidol and thereby the methyl methacrylate-methanol azeotrope withdrawn from the column head via a 1 meter Vigreux column at about 65° C. After 2.5 hours, the reaction was ended, which was shown by the increase of the head temperature. The sump was filtered free of potassium cyanide and washed with a little methyl methacrylate. After distilling off the methyl methacrylate there remained behind 132 grams of glycidyl methacrylate (93% yield). The product can be worked up by distillation for further purification (B.P.10, 71°-75° C.).
